Understanding Heater Blower Motors: Function and Importance

Heater blower motors play a vital role in vehicle climate control. They circulate air through the heating and cooling systems. Understanding this component is crucial for maintaining comfort during colder months. A malfunctioning blower motor can lead to poor airflow. It might cause delays in cabin heating, affecting your driving experience.

One common issue is the motor becoming noisy or failing altogether. This could indicate wear and tear over time. Regular inspections can help catch these problems early. Look for signs like inconsistent airflow or strange noises. These symptoms often point to underlying issues. Addressing them promptly can save time and repair costs.

Key Factors in Selecting the Right Heater Blower Motor

When selecting a heater blower motor, several key factors should guide your decision. Understanding your vehicle's specifications is crucial. Each model has a unique design. Ensure compatibility to avoid overheating or inefficient airflow. Research various motor types, as they vary in performance and durability.

Another factor is the motor's power output. A higher wattage often translates to better heating capabilities. However, you need to balance power with energy efficiency. A motor that is too powerful for your vehicle may waste energy. This consideration is vital for long-term costs.

Moreover, examining customer reviews can offer insights into reliability. Many users share their personal experiences, helping you gauge the product's performance. Keep an eye on warranties as well. A good warranty indicates the manufacturer stands behind their product. It's essential to weigh these aspects carefully while making your choice.

Exploring Compatibility: Vehicle Models and Blower Motor Specifications

When selecting a heater blower motor, compatibility remains a critical factor. It's essential to match the motor with specific vehicle models and their electrical systems. Data from the Automotive Parts Association suggests that mismatched components can lead to inefficiencies, resulting in 20% reduced airflow. This not only impacts cabin comfort but may also increase energy consumption.

Understanding specifications like amperage, voltage, and mounting styles is vital. Different vehicles have unique requirements. For example, many modern cars use blower motors with integrated speed controls, which need precise matching to function properly. Over 30% of installation failures stem from compatibility issues, indicating the importance of thorough verification.

Tips: Always consult the vehicle manual before purchasing. Ensure the specifications align closely. It also helps to check online forums and guidance from experienced mechanics. When in doubt, consider consulting with professionals. They can help navigate the specifics of air flow rates and compatibility, ensuring you select the right motor for your needs.

Maintenance Tips to Extend the Life of Heater Blower Motors

Maintaining your heater blower motor is crucial for its longevity. Regular maintenance can prevent costly repairs. One key aspect is keeping the motor clean. Dust and debris can build up over time. This buildup can reduce efficiency and airflow. Regularly checking and cleaning the motor can help maintain optimal performance.

Another useful practice is to lubricate the motor bearings. Proper lubrication minimizes friction, which can prolong the motor's life. It is wise to use the correct type of lubricant. Over time, you may notice sounds that indicate wear or damage. Pay attention to these signs. Addressing them early can prevent further issues.

Additionally, ensure proper electrical connections. Inspecting wiring and connections for corrosion is essential. A secure connection will enhance efficiency and performance. Sometimes, it’s easy to overlook these details. However, being proactive can save time and money down the road.

Taking steps to maintain your heater blower motor can make a significant difference.
